    I came back to Indiana in 1985. There was only one Indy 1500 a year back then. We trekked around the state to gun shows but we noticed some shows had lots of military weapons and clothing. It is what it is. If the promoter enforces the rules and doesn't let the military surplus vendors or the preppers in, they lose money. Some of the shows were great, some went under. I remember the Fort Wayne Coloseum show was really good but now, not so much. Personally, I like the smaller shows as the vendors will deal with you.
